As Di's health continues to decline, my time here is more and more limited. Will listen and comment as much as possible.

I wrote this one a few hours ago and recorded it a few minutes ago. This is the result of about two hours work, total. The vocal is a little loud but will pull it back when I get a chance. And yes, the lyric is pretty sparse, but it says everything I wanted to say. Everything else I tried to add sound like fluff. Thanks for giving it a spin, if you do!

Key=C , Tempo 66, Length (m:s)=4:21
Style is _BALADAP.STY (Country Ballad w/ Piano )

RealTracks in style: 366:Bass, Electric, Country Ev 065
RealTracks in style: 1725:Piano, Acoustic, Rhythm CountryBalladJohn Ev 065
RealTracks in style: ~368:Guitar, Acoustic, Strumming Ev 065
RealTracks in song: 2542:Pedal Steel, Background ModernBalladAtmosphere Ev16 065
RealTracks in song: 1513:Guitar, Electric, Soloist CountryBrent Ev 065
RealTracks in song: 1410:Piano, SynthLayer, Rhythm Soul70sA-B Ev16 100
RealDrums in style: NashvilleEven16^5-a:Snare, HiHat , b:Snare, Ride
